免费实用工具:AIX下如何查看DB2数据库信息 (aix 查看db2数据库)

DB2是IBM公司的一个关系数据库管理系统,广泛应用于企业信息化建设中。在X系统中,DB2数据库是提高企业数据处理能力和效率的关键因素之一。因此,在日常运营过程中,了解DB2数据库的相关信息是非常必要的。本文将介绍如何使用X系统下的免费工具查看DB2数据库信息。

一、环境准备

在查询DB2数据库信息之前,我们需要先安装DB2客户端,并配置相应的环境变量。具体操作步骤如下:

1. 下载DB2客户端,网址:https://www.ibm.com/ytics/db2-trial/

2. 在终端中执行以下命令,安装DB2客户端。

$ tar -xzvf /path/to/db2setup.tar.gz

$ cd /path/to/db2setup

$ ./db2_install

3. 安装完毕后,设置环境变量。在终端中执行以下命令:

$ vi ~/.bashrc

在文件的最后一行添加以下命令:

export DB2HOME=/home/db2inst1/sqllib

export PATH=$PATH:$DB2HOME/bin

export LD_LIBRARY_PATH=$LD_LIBRARY_PATH:$DB2HOME/lib

执行以下命令,使环境变量生效。

$ source ~/.bashrc

二、查看DB2实例信息

执行以下命令,查看DB2实例信息:

$ db2ilist

命令执行后,将返回已安装的DB2实例名称列表。

三、查看DB2数据库信息

1. 使用db2命令进入DB2客户端。

$ db2

2. 进入DB2客户端后,执行以下命令,列出所有的数据库:

db2 list database directory

3. 如果想要查看某一数据库的详细信息,可以执行以下命令:

db2 connect to [database_name] user [user_name] using [password]

db2 get db cfg

以上命令将连接到指定的数据库,并列出该数据库的详细参数信息。

四、查看DB2表空间信息

表空间是DB2数据库中的一个重要概念,用于管理存储在数据库内的数据及其索引。查看表空间信息可以帮助了解数据库使用情况。执行以下命令,查看表空间信息:

1. 在DB2客户端中,执行以下命令,查询所有表空间:

db2 list tablespaces show detl

2. 如果想要查看某一表空间的详细信息,可以执行以下命令:

db2 connect to [database_name] user [user_name] using [password]

db2 list tablespaces for database [database_name] show detl

以上命令将连接到指定的数据库,并列出该数据库中所有表空间的详细参数信息。

五、查看DB2用户信息

在DB2数据库中,用户是管理和访问数据的重要角色。查看用户信息可以帮助管理员了解DB2数据库的使用情况和权限分配情况。执行以下命令,查看用户信息:

1. 在DB2客户端中,执行以下命令,查看所有用户:

db2 list users

2. 如果想要查看某一用户的详细信息,可以执行以下命令:

db2 connect to [database_name] user [user_name] using [password]

db2 select * from SYSCAT.USERS where USERNAME = ‘[user_name]’

以上命令将连接到指定的数据库,并列出该数据库中指定用户的详细参数信息。

DB2是企业级数据库管理系统,是企业数据处理能力的关键因素之一。在X系统中,查看DB2数据库信息是企业运营不可或缺的一环。使用本文介绍的方法,你可以轻松地查看DB2实例、数据库、表空间和用户信息,获取更多有价值的数据信息,为企业运营管理提供有力支持。

相关问题拓展阅读:

如何查询db2数据库表是否被锁

1、首先点击桌面上的SQL server数蔽饥晌据库。

2、然后肢早打开SQL server数据库宏锋,输入登录名,密码,点击连接。

3、接着点击左上角新建查询,选择master数据库。

4、先查看数据库被锁的表。

5、接着输入解锁进程,然后执行就可以进行数据库解锁了。

求AIX平台DB2数据库的迁移方案?

如果是从aix–aix,直接使用backup restore 即可。

如果是不同的平台:

db2look 导出表结构

db2move export导出数据

在目标库:

db2look 建结构

db2move load 导入数据

1、需考虑的步骤:

记录源数据库管理系统配置参数,以备迁移过后数据库系统性能调优;

检查源数据库系统对象,明确要迁移哪些数据库系统对象;

导出源数据库系统的数据集;

生成源数据库系统的数据对象定义语句;

在目标平台创建新的数据库,参照源系统进行设置;

导入源数据集;

检查数据集导入过程日志,排除可能的错误;

执行数据对象定义语句;

检查数据对象语句执行日志,排除可能的错误;

检查更新存储过程的定义;

连接应用系统,测试数据库迁移是否成功。

2、 源库:

db2look 导出表结构

db2move export导出数据

目标库:

db2look 建结构

db2move load 导入数据

aix 查看db2数据库的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于aix 查看db2数据库,免费实用工具:AIX下如何查看DB2数据库信息,如何查询db2数据库表是否被锁,求AIX平台DB2数据库的迁移方案?的信息别忘了在本站进行查找喔。


数据运维技术 » 免费实用工具:AIX下如何查看DB2数据库信息 (aix 查看db2数据库)